Quick Verdict
PawLove 6-in Gullies Dog Treats are generally well-liked by dogs, but there are mixed reviews regarding durability and hygiene. Some users report significant positive aspects while others express concerns about spoilage and diarrhea.

Bottom Line
If looking for a treat that dogs enjoy and is a bit safer, these are a good option. However, ensure to check the product itself for spoilage on your end since there have been considerable reports of hygiene failures. Durability-wise these are not intended for long-term use and may not last particularly long if the dog finishes them in a short time.
